I upgraded to Mavericks on Thursday using a USB stick and it went perfectly. There's no longer any need to go through that weird process to get audio working on this board. The current drivers in Multibeast work brilliantly. Current MultiBeast config:

I added
Code:
<key>SMmaximalclock</key>
<string>4000</string>
to my SMBios to fix reporting of my overclock in System Information. Mavericks was reporting 3.9GHz even though the OC is 4GHz.

iMessage now working by including
FileNVRAM 1.1.2 in /Extra/modules (1.1.3 does not work).
